Job Description Baker Tilly’s Accounting and Finance Services Transition team is seeking a detail-oriented, tech-savvy Project Manager – Accountant. You’ll lead client onboarding, manage accounting software implementations, optimize financial processes, and ensure accurate reporting. This role combines accounting expertise, project management, and technology skills to deliver high-quality client service and process improvements.
Key Responsibilities
Client Onboarding
Serve as primary contact for new clients, assess needs, and gather financial/operational data
Define onboarding timelines, milestones, and expectations; manage budgets and deliverables
Identify and communicate roadblocks, propose improvements, and ensure client satisfaction
Software Implementation & Optimization
Configure and customize cloud accounting platforms (Sage Intacct, QuickBooks Online, NetSuite)
Integrate third-party tools (bill pay, payroll, expense management)
Train clients and internal teams; improve efficiency and accuracy of systems
Accounting Processes & Cleanup
Streamline workflows, document SOPs, and implement best practices
Provide initial accounting services (reconciliations, schedules, financial statements) before transition to recurring teams
Maintain strong knowledge of accounting principles and practices
Financial Review & Reporting
Review financial records, reconcile accounts, and resolve discrepancies
Prepare GAAP-compliant financial statements and ensure timely, accurate reporting
Qualifications
Bachelor’s in Accounting, Finance, or related field; CPA preferred
8+ years in accounting/finance operations; 5+ years in project management/client implementation
Expertise with cloud accounting software and 3rd parties (e.g., QuickBooks Online, Sage Intacct, NetSuite, ADP, Bill.com, Expensify)
Strong GAAP knowledge, analytical skills, and ability to manage multiple projects
Excellent communication, organizational, and client-facing skills
Ability to train, collaborate across levels (staff to C-suite), and deliver quality results under deadlines
Preferred Skills
Consulting or client service experience
ERP/software migration background
Familiarity with project management tools (e.g., SmartSheet)
Experience with accounting process and tech stack assessments
